Web13 mrt. 2024 · The standard recipe for homemade hummingbird nectar is four parts water to one part sugar, so two cups of water for every half cup of sugar or four cups of water to one cup of sugar. That’s it. Tap water is generally fine to use. If your water source is high in minerals, put it in a glass measuring cup and microwave until it boils.

Web6 okt. 2024 · If you’re asking whether a hummingbird feeder can be hung too high off the ground, the answer is technically no. However, if the feeder is too high for comfortable viewing or for easy filling and cleaning, then it might as well be too high! The ideal height for a hummingbird feeder is about 6-8 feet off the ground.
